Did you know that 72% of Finland is covered by forest? This makes Finland one of the most forested countries in the world. The country's vast forests provide a habitat for a variety of wildlife, including bears, wolves, and reindeer. In addition to its ecological importance, Finland's forests also play a crucial role in the country's economy.

Forestry is a major industry in Finland, with timber production being one of the country's largest exports. The forestry sector also provides employment for thousands of people in rural areas. In recent years, Finland has made efforts to promote sustainable forestry practices in order to protect its valuable natural resources for future generations.

One of the key challenges facing Finland's forests is climate change. As temperatures rise and weather patterns become more unpredictable, the country's forests are at risk from wildfires, pests, and diseases. In response, the Finnish government has implemented measures to improve forest management and increase resilience to climate change.

Finland's forests are also important for recreation and tourism. The country is known for its pristine wilderness areas, which attract visitors from around the world. Tourists can enjoy activities such as hiking, fishing, and berry picking in Finland's forests, providing a boost to the local economy.

In conclusion, Finland's forests are a vital resource for the country, both ecologically and economically. With 72% of the country covered by forest, Finland is truly a land of trees. By promoting sustainable forestry practices and addressing the challenges posed by climate change, Finland can ensure that its forests continue to thrive for generations to come.
